The only place where panthor_irq::state is accessed without
panthor_irq::mask_lock held is in the prologue of _irq_suspend(),
which is not really a fast-path. So let's simplify things by assuming
panthor_irq::state must always be accessed with the mask_lock held,
and add a scoped_guard() in _irq_suspend().
